The Faculty of Economics and Business Administration (FEBA) and the Faculty of Physics of the Sofia University “St. Kliment Ohridski” announce admission to the master’s program in English – “Nuclear Technologies, Management, and Innovations”, created jointly by lecturers in both faculties and by key practitioners in the industry. The application process is between 1 and 31 January 2026 and the first module of lectures will start on 30 March 2026.
The master’s program “Nuclear Technologies, Management, and Innovations” is created under professional field 3.7 “Administration and Management” with a duration of four semesters and is entirely conducted in English. The program’s courses will be taught by faculty members of Sofia University, distinguished practitioners, as well as guest lecturers from foreign and Bulgarian scientific organizations, institutions, and companies.
The programme is implemented on the model of the International Atomic Energy Agency (IAEA) for the so-called International Nuclear Management Academy (INMA). The programmes included in the INMA initiative are aimed at current and future managers working in the nuclear energy sector as well as for non-energy applications. INMA is part of the nuclear knowledge management activities of the IAEA Department of Nuclear Energy. More about INMA here.
